Description

This Letter from Landlord to Tenant with Directions regarding cleaning and procedures for move-out can be sent by Landlord to Tenant when Tenant is about to move out. It instructs and reminds the Tenant on cleaning, return of security deposit, disconnection of utilities and other move-out matters that can often be overlooked.

FAQ

To write a moving out letter to a landlord, begin by addressing the letter formally and including all relevant details such as your name, address, and move-out date. Clearly state that this letter serves as your formal notice to vacate. To write a letter that indicates you are moving out, start with a clear subject line, such as 'Notice of Intent to Vacate.' State your name, rental address, and the specific date you will be leaving. This concise approach helps keep the communication professional and straightforward.
